Local Woman Ecstatic after Winning Big in Hospice Lottery

29 September 2022

Local Woman Ecstatic after Winning Big in Hospice Lottery image

Nethy Bridge resident Nancy Gordon is feeling over the moon after winning £18,000 through supporting Highland Hospice in the Local Hospice Lottery rollover.

Local Hospice Lottery is a non-profit organisation that runs a weekly lottery in aid of adult and children hospices across the country. Everyone that takes part has the chance to win some fantastic cash prizes while raising money for their desired hospice. It is a fun and affordable way to support a great cause.

After her amazing win, Nancy said the following, “I am absolutely delighted. I couldn’t believe it when I got the call, I thought it was just another telephone scam. Never in a million years did I think I would be a winner, it still hasn’t sunk in yet. I am just so pleased to have been able to support Highland Hospice by taking part in the Local Hospice Lottery, to actually win something is just a bonus.”

Cheryl Bunkle, Director of Marketing & Account Management for Local Hospice Lottery commented, “Local Hospice Lottery has been working with Highland Hospice since 2012 and since that time, their wonderful supporters have helped to raise over £2.2Million for the Hospice through taking part in the Lottery!! It may only be £1 per entry to take part and play, but these contributions add up and make a REALLY big difference to the amount of hospice care that can be provided locally and we are very proud to work with Highland Hospice and help raise this vital funding for them.”

“And in addition to the Hospice winning each week thanks to the money raised, Mrs Gordon’s recent windfall shows how, as a supporter and a player, you could receive a pretty amazing cash prize too! We’d like to wish her massive congratulations and also the most sincerest of thanks for her very kind and ongoing support for Highland Hospice through playing the Lottery.”
